Key Responsibilities
Purchasing Support - Assist Buyers and Sourcing Specialists with daily purchasing and administrative tasks.
Vendor Communication - Contact vendors for shipment updates, backorder details, and PO status.
Order Tracking - Monitor open purchase orders and follow up to ensure timely fulfillment.
ERP Data Entry - Maintain accurate purchasing records within Oracle and internal systems.
Order Management - Support order confirmations, delivery updates, and vendor inquiries.
Internal Updates - Communicate shipment delays and order status to internal teams.
Reporting - Update spreadsheets and reports supporting supply chain activities.
Administrative Support - Provide general administrative support, including data entry and document management.
